Young, age 78, of Lake Odessa, passed away Sunday, October 26, 1997 at Pennock Hospital. Mr. Young was born on August 1, 1919 in Alma, the son of Nelson and Lydia (Moon) Young. He graduated from Saranac High School in 1936. He was married to Ellen Strouse on June 8, 1940 in Cedar Springs. My Young farmed and owned and operated the Young's Tractor Sales and Service, also a welding shop. He was a member and past Exaulted Ruler of the BPOE Elks Lodge 1965 of Hastings and the Moose Lodge. Mr. Young was preceded in death by a brother, Bruce Young in 1987. He is survived by his wife, Ellen; one daughter, RoseMary Johnson of Longwood, Florida; four grandchildren, Dennis (Malissia) Johnson of Franklin, Tennessee, K. Joseph (Dana) Johnson of Sanford, Florida, Kenneth Johnson of Longwood, Florida and Becky (Rick) Galloway of New York; seven great grandchildren; two sisters, Ellen Burgi of LaGrange, Indiana and Luella Nash of Ionia; a sister- in-law, Alvena Baldry of Middleville and several nieces and nephews. Lodge of Sorrow services at 8:00 p.m. on Tuesday, October 28, 1997. Funeral services were held on Wednesday, October 29, 1997 at the Koops Funeral Chapel in Lake Odessa. Reverend Doug Richenbach officiated. Interment took place at Lakeside Cemetery. Memorial contributions may be made to Elks major project to help needy children.
